PyConDE & PyData Berlin 2024

Yuliia Barabash

I have lived in Germany for the past five years, during which I have gained a diverse range of experiences in the tech industry. My expertise spans from developing web applications in Python to constructing AWS cloud solutions. I have a good understanding of design patterns, Object-Oriented Programming (OOP), event-driven architecture, and microservices architectures. Additionally, I have hands-on experience with REST API design and database technologies. I am continuously committed to enhancing my skills and ensuring that I utilize tools in the best practices.


LinkedIn

https://www.linkedin.com/in/yuliia-barabash/


Session

04-23
11:40
30min
Boost your app to Flash speed by mastering performance tricks
Laysa Uchoa, Yuliia Barabash

In this talk, we discuss computational operations and memory utilization in Python and what is the connection between them. Additionally, we will provide you with visual aids for helping to build a mental picture of these concepts. Moreover, we will dive into how Python interpreter works and how the understanding of bytecode instructions can help you write better code. In the end, we will demonstrate the advantages of best practices by comparing both performance metrics and bytecode instructions.

PyCon: Python Language & Ecosystem
B05-B06